This guide is for U.S. households. All dollar amounts are U.S. dollars (USD); electricity rates are in cents per kilowatt-hour (kWh). Use local quotes and your utility rate rather than treating the examples as prices available in your area.

In the fictional refrigerator example below, a replacement saves $60 a year in electricity but costs $750 more upfront than a repair. Over five years, repairing costs $450 less, assuming both refrigerators last through the comparison and no other costs differ. Those assumptions matter as much as the price tags.

Get a diagnosis and check coverage first

Start with the fault and a written repair quote. Record the model number, the diagnosed problem, parts availability, expected completion date and what the proposed repair covers. Ask whether the diagnostic charge is included in the quote or credited toward the work.

Check the appliance's warranty and any service contract before assuming you must pay the whole bill. Coverage can differ for parts, labor and particular failures. The FTC recommends reading the written terms and keeping the receipt; a separately purchased service contract is different from the warranty included with a product.

For a rented home, establish who owns the appliance and who should authorize work under your agreement before paying for a replacement.

Age helps frame the questions, but it does not tell you how long this particular appliance will last. Ask the technician whether the quote resolves the diagnosed fault, whether other problems are evident, and what uncertainty remains. Do not turn a general lifespan estimate into a promise of additional service.

Compare complete prices, not a repair quote against a shelf price

Make two lists of costs you would incur from today onward.

Repair optionReplacement option
Remaining diagnostic or service-call chargesAppliance purchase price
Parts and laborSales tax and delivery
Tax and other quoted chargesInstallation and required connection parts
Temporary arrangements while waitingRemoval and disposal of the old appliance
Any known follow-up workNecessary fit or access changes
Less confirmed warranty coverage or creditsLess confirmed discounts, rebates or sale proceeds

Ask for itemized quotes so charges are counted once. If a diagnostic fee has already been paid and cannot be recovered under either choice, it is a shared past cost: record it in your overall spending, but do not let it distort the decision between the remaining options. A fee credited only if you approve the repair changes the repair balance still due.

For replacement, confirm the model meets the same household need and fits the space. The FTC advises checking appliance dimensions, door opening and ventilation clearance.

Treat a possible rebate separately until you verify eligibility, the application process and payment timing. ENERGY STAR provides a rebate finder. A rebate paid later may reduce the eventual cost without reducing the cash needed on delivery day.

Calculate the electricity difference

For each refrigerator, collect a supported annual energy estimate in kWh and apply the same electricity rate:

Annual electricity cost = annual kWh × dollars per kWh.

Annual electricity savings = existing appliance cost − replacement cost.

EnergyGuide's dollar figure uses typical usage and a national energy-price assumption; it is not a quote for your home. Use annual kWh with your own rate. If the label is missing, check the seller's or manufacturer's website.

Our EnergyGuide article explains the inputs in more detail. Keep uncertain consumption estimates visibly separate from measured use. Do not assume an older refrigerator uses a particular amount solely because of its age.

Use the consumption-dependent charges relevant to your electricity savings. A fixed monthly customer charge usually remains after replacing an appliance. One flat rate is also only an approximation where prices depend on time or usage tiers. The electricity-rate guide explains the distinction between a bill rate and a state benchmark.

Worked example: a $350 repair or $1,100 replacement

Every input here is fictional. These are not national average repair prices, current retail offers or typical refrigerator consumption figures.

Assume the repair restores normal operation, both options provide five years of service, electricity stays at 20 cents/kWh, and the old refrigerator is removed if replaced. For this simplified comparison, assume no financing, further repairs, downtime costs or difference in ending resale value. These are undiscounted costs: future payments are added at their stated dollar amounts without adjusting for the time value of money.

Fictional refrigerator comparison: five years, quantity one, 20 cents/kWh
Input or calculated costRepair existing refrigeratorBuy replacement
Upfront cost, including applicable quoted charges$350$1,100
Annual electricity use700 kWh400 kWh
Electricity rate$0.20/kWh$0.20/kWh
Annual electricity cost$140$80
Five years of electricity$700$400
Upfront cost plus five years of electricity$1,050$1,500

The replacement reduces electricity spending by $60 per year, or $5 per month on average. Its upfront premium is $1,100 − $350 = $750. Five years of energy savings recover $300 of that premium, leaving repair $450 cheaper under the stated assumptions.

That $450 is also a useful sensitivity check: an additional $450 of repair-path costs, with everything else unchanged, would erase the modeled advantage. This is a threshold, not a prediction of future breakdowns.

Use payback carefully

For these two choices, electricity-only simple payback is:

Additional upfront cost of replacement ÷ positive annual electricity savings.

Here, $750 ÷ $60 = 12.5 years. That is longer than the five-year comparison, and it is not evidence that either appliance will last 12.5 more years. Simple payback omits financing, future repairs, changing rates and the timing of costs.

The starting point matters. When comparing replacement against repairing a broken appliance, subtract the repair cost you avoid. When comparing replacement against continuing to use a working appliance with no immediate repair needed, there may be no repair bill to subtract. Do not mix these two decisions.

If the new model has equal or higher electricity costs, a positive extra purchase cost has no electricity-only payback. Replacement might still solve another problem, but energy savings would not justify it.

Test the assumptions that could change your choice

An electricity rate is one source of uncertainty. Keeping every other input from the example unchanged gives:

Illustrative electricity rateAnnual electricity savings from replacementFive-year repair totalFive-year replacement totalRepair costs less by
15 cents/kWh$45$875$1,400$525
20 cents/kWh$60$1,050$1,500$450
30 cents/kWh$90$1,400$1,700$300

These are scenarios, not forecasts. Higher rates increase the value of using less energy, but replacement still costs more over five years in all three examples.

Remaining life can matter more. If the repaired appliance may last only two years, do not compare two years of service against five years from the replacement and call the cheaper total a winner. Either compare both over a shorter common period or include the replacement and running costs needed to complete the longer period. If that later purchase remains unknown, show a range or leave the longer-term decision unresolved.

Also consider future repair costs on either option, financing charges, temporary arrangements and any meaningful difference in resale value at the end. Only include future amounts you can reasonably support, and test uncertain ones separately. Past purchase prices are not new spending caused by today's decision.

Should I automatically replace an appliance when the repair costs half as much?

No single percentage completes the comparison. A repair-to-replacement ratio leaves out remaining life, operating costs, installation and warranty coverage. Use it as a reason to compare the options carefully, not as an automatic decision rule.

Does a more efficient refrigerator always save enough to justify replacement?

No. Lower energy use reduces operating costs at the same rate, but those savings may not recover the extra purchase cost within your ownership period. In the worked example, the new model saves electricity while still costing more over five years.

What if I keep the old refrigerator as a second fridge?

Then it is no longer a replacement-only energy comparison. Count the electricity for both appliances. ENERGY STAR recommends recycling an old refrigerator when replacing it and notes that many retailers offer pickup and recycling. Confirm the service and any fee with the seller.

Can I use this for a washer, dryer or dishwasher?

The same cost worksheet can help, but the relevant operating expenses differ. Add water, sewer, gas or other costs where applicable. The current RealCostTools calculator estimates electricity; it does not calculate those additional expenses or diagnose a fault.
